Fallen Tree Removal in Reno, NV

Fallen tree removal services involve safely taking down and removing trees that have fallen due to storms, decay, or other causes, as well as removing trees that pose a safety risk or obstruct property features. This service covers a range of projects, including clearing debris after storms, removing hazardous or dead trees, and managing trees that are too close to structures or utility lines. Property owners typically want to understand the process involved, the scope of work needed for their specific situation, and any potential impact on their landscape or property access before requesting assistance.

Before requesting fallen tree removal, property owners should assess the size and location of the tree, noting any potential hazards such as proximity to power lines, buildings, or walkways. It is also helpful to consider whether the tree is completely fallen or partially leaning, as this can influence the removal approach. Understanding the extent of debris cleanup needed and any restrictions in the property area can aid in planning the project effectively. Contacting a professional can provide guidance on the best course of action to ensure safety and proper disposal of the tree material.

FAQ

Fallen Tree Removal Questions

What situations require fallen tree removal? Removal is needed when a tree is damaged, dead, or poses a hazard to property or safety.

How can I tell if a tree is unsafe? Signs include large cracks, leaning, broken branches, or visible decay.

What are the benefits of professional fallen tree removal? It ensures safe and efficient removal, preventing further damage to the property.

Is fallen tree removal necessary after a storm? Yes, removing storm-damaged trees helps prevent accidents and property damage.
